Patent number: 7054742Abstract: A method for route calculation using real time traffic conditions is disclosed. A transmission that includes weightings indicative of traffic conditions on roads is received. Then, a solution route is calculated by forming a list of road segments. The list is formed by expanding a search tree comprised of gates. Each gate represents a physical location on a road segment and an accessible direction relative thereto. Each gate to which a weighting applies is incremented by an amount indicated in the transmission. The solution route is determined by expanding the search tree, which includes determining and evaluating successor gates.Type: GrantFiled: August 28, 2003Date of Patent: May 30, 2006Assignee: Navteq North America, LLCInventors: Asta Khavakh, William McDonough, Oleg Voloshin, Yaoguang Wang

Publication number: 20040039520Abstract: A program and method for route calculation for use with a navigation system and used with a map database that represents a road network in a geographic region. A route calculation program is adapted to find at least one solution route between a first location on a road network and a second location on the road network. The route calculation program includes a first search tree associated with the first location and a second search tree associated with the second location. Each search tree is adapted to hold gates. Each of the gates represents a physical position on the road network and a direction from the position to another location along a path on the road network. The route calculation program also includes at least one priority queue associated with one of the search trees. The priority queue assigns a priority to one of the gates in the associated search tree based upon an evaluation using a search algorithm.Type: ApplicationFiled: August 28, 2003Publication date: February 26, 2004Inventors: Asta Khavakh, William McDonough, Oleg Voloshin, Yaoguang Wang

Patent number: 5731411Abstract: A peptide having at least 15 consecutive amino acids of the amino acid sequence shown in SEQ ID NO:1 or conservative amino acid substitutions thereof. The peptide is capable of promoting pairing of a single-stranded DNA molecule and a double-stranded DNA molecule. The single-stranded DNA molecule is homologous to at least a portion of the double-stranded DNA molecule. The single-stranded DNA molecule and the double-stranded DNA molecule form a three-stranded DNA molecule.Type: GrantFiled: June 7, 1995Date of Patent: March 24, 1998Assignee: The United States of America as represented by the Department of Health and Human ServicesInventors: Oleg Voloshin, Lijiang Wang, R.
